Does a line have 2 endpoints?

A line is a straight path on a plane that extends forever in both directions with no endpoints. A line segment is part of a line that has two endpoints and is finite in length. A ray is a line segment that extends indefinitely in one direction.

What is the endpoint of a line?

Endpoints are the points on either end of a line segment or on one end of a ray. The midpoint of a line segment is the point that lies halfway between the endpoints.

What has only 1 endpoint?

A ray is a line that only has one defined endpoint and one side that extends endlessly away from the endpoint. A ray is named by its endpoint and by another point on the line. The angle that is formed by two rays that have the same endpoint is called the vertex.

Does a line have infinite points?

A line extends in both directions without bound; this is why lines are usually depicted with arrows on each end. Its length is infinite, and between any two points on a line, there lie an infinite number of other points.

How do you find endpoints?

Given the starting point, A , and the midpoint, B , draw the line segment that connects the two. Draw a line going farther from B away from A to God-knows-where. Measure the distance from A to B and mark the same distance from B going the other way. The point you marked is the endpoint you seek.

Is a line made up of points?

A line consists of infinitely many points. The four points A, B, C, D are all on the same line. Postulate: Two points determine a line. Any three or more points that are on the same line are called colinear points.

What is called line?

A line is a one-dimensional figure, which has length but no width. A line is made of a set of points which is extended in opposite directions infinitely. It is determined by two points in a two-dimensional plane. The two points which lie on the same line are said to be collinear points.

Which line has a slope of zero?

horizontal line Zero slope is when the slope of an equation or line is equal to zero. This produces a horizontal line. A vertical line is not a zero slope line because the slope is undefined, not zero. The equation for a zero slope line is y = b, which means that y is equal to a constant.

What is y2 y1 x2 x1?

Use the slope formula to find the slope of a line given the coordinates of two points on the line. The slope formula is m=(y2-y1)/(x2-x1), or the change in the y values over the change in the x values. The coordinates of the first point represent x1 and y1. The coordinates of the second points are x2, y2.
